Small strips of fish or prawn tight to the bottom in rocky holes; slow retrieve LRF works; fish mid to high tide; year-round.
Small baits tight to rock features; short casts with light gear; fish low water in gullies then follow tide up.
Tiny hooks and small worm/prawn pieces lowered into rock holes at low water and early flood. Keep baits static in pockets and expect quick takes.
Micro gear; tiny worm/prawn dropped into rock holes and kelp fringes at low water; year-round resident.
Micro soft plastics or small worm/prawn baits slowly in among stones and kelp fringes; best on slack or start of the flood. Sensitive tip helps.
Tiny rag bits or micro metals tight to boulders around low water. Static baits work; year-round.
Tiny hooks and worm or prawn baits lowered into rock gullies. Keep line short to avoid snags. Best around high water.
LRF around rockpools and kelp fringes; small worm/prawn baits on size 12–14 hooks. Best on a making tide.
LRF: tiny hooks and fish bits lowered into rockpools/gullies; handle carefully and release.
LRF with small worm/isome around boulders and rockpools on the flood; handle and release carefully.
